Miramar Beach, FL Real Estate Trends
Learn about the Miramar Beach, FL housing market through trends and averages.Affordability of Living in Miramar Beach, FL
| Month | Median home value |
|---|---|
| May 2025 | $664k |
| June 2025 | $658k |
| July 2025 | $654k |
| August 2025 | $651k |
| September 2025 | $648k |
| October 2025 | $645k |
| November 2025 | $642k |
| December 2025 | $641k |
| January 2026 | $640k |
| February 2026 | $641k |
| March 2026 | $645k |
| April 2026 | $648k |

Average Home Value in Miramar Beach, FL, by Home Size
Currently, there are 28 new listings in Miramar Beach, FL and 802 homes for sale.
| Home Size | Home Value* |
|---|---|
| 1 bedroom (114 homes) | $340,341 |
| 2 bedrooms (241 homes) | $544,135 |
| 3 bedrooms (205 homes) | $766,953 |
| 4 bedrooms (98 homes) | $1,177,512 |
What Locals Say about Miramar Beach
Review Highlights
Miramar Beach offers steady coastal living: safe, family-friendly, good schools, solid resale. People like the safety, beaches, good schools, dog-friendly vibe, and walkable amenities. They dislike heavy summer traffic, tourist churn, scarce playgrounds, weak transit, and Scenic 98 risks.
